The British Sign and Graphics Association was formerly known as the British Sign Association, and was established in 1977. It is widely acknowledged as the sign industry's leading body and currently has almost 200 members. It is the aim of the BSGA to promote high quality and best practice amongst its members. To this end it has published a code of practice to which all members are obliged to adhere.
Membership of the BSGA has provided Campbell Sign Services with access to resources covering:
Technical guidelines encompassing all aspects of sign design, specification, materials and electrical installation.
Information on the latest legal requirements regarding European Standards for signage and including Health and Safety and Environmental legislation.
Detailed information on the current planning regulations and a say in the policy-making of the Government bodies controlling the legislation at national and local levels.
